Course assessment tools are digital or physical platforms and methodologies used by educators and institutions to evaluate students' understanding, skills, and progress throughout a course. These tools facilitate the creation, administration, and analysis of assessments such as quizzes, exams, assignments, projects, and surveys, enabling more efficient and effective measurement of learning outcomes.

Key Features

  • Automated grading and feedback
  • Customizable assessment formats (multiple-choice, essays, practical tasks)
  • Analytics and reporting capabilities
  • Integration with Learning Management Systems (LMS)
  • Secure test environments
  • Rubric-based evaluation
  • Instant result delivery
  • Collaboration and peer assessment options

Pros

  • Enhances efficiency in administering assessments
  • Provides immediate feedback to students
  • Enables detailed analytics for better understanding of student performance
  • Flexible assessment formats cater to diverse learning styles
  • Facilitates remote and online learning environments

Cons

  • Technical difficulties can disrupt testing processes
  • Potential for academic dishonesty without proper safeguards
  • Learning curve associated with new software tools
  • Limited access for students lacking reliable internet or devices
  • Risk of over-reliance on quantitative data at the expense of qualitative insights
